Microsoft confirmed its $100 million purchase of Powerset. Microsoft has announced that they’ve reached an aggreement with Powerset already where this aggreement highlights the purchase of the much-hyped search engine Powerset for $100 million.

Starbucks Corp. closing 600 underperforming stores. The Seattle-based premium coffee company Starbucks Corp. announced that it will be closing 600 underperforming stores in the United States. On top of that they also announced that they’ll be opening a few more company-operated stores by 2009 and would accommodate those employees affected by the previous closure.

Bill Gates last day at Microsoft. Bill Gates, the world’s most famous university dropout emulated by Mark Zuckerberg of Facebook will today leave his Seattle office. This time Bill Gates will formally give up his full-time job at Microsoft and concentrate on his charitable foundation.
